I have a great local indie shop that I go to for things I don't have the diagnostic equipment, tools, or skills to do. My 2005 S-Type has been there for two different issues in not quite 8 years of ownership. My wife's 2006 XK8 has not had to go there yet in not quite 5 years of ownership. The owner is honest and charges a fair price. He always takes the time to speak with me when I call him looking for advice and he knows I will bring our cars to him only when I've decided the repair is beyond my abilities. The only downside is that they stay very busy so it may be a week or more until they can get to my car....
The only time any of our four vehicles go to dealerships is for warranty or recall issues.... |
